Stay. Easy choice.

1) City of Hoover does an outstanding job managing it
2) Stadium is in great shape
3) Ton of parking, great traffic control
4) Ton of RV parking
5) Great college atmosphere, family friendly, travel ball and kids teams everywhere
6) Plenty of hotels and restaurants within 5 minute drive of stadium
7) City is building a huge sports facility adjacent which will only add activities.

If you've ever been, you realize it's about the baseball, NOT the nightlife. You put it in a downtown setting next to bars and such, you're changing the entire landscape. That's fine if it's the way you want to go, but I don't think it is. Just my opinion. The City of Hoover does as well with this as the City of Atlanta does with the SEC football championship. Moving it would be change for the sake of change, which sucks.
